Traction
Traction should be one of your foremost considerations. The better the traction between the tire and chain and the ground’s surface, the better the ATV will perform to prevent any skids and get the ATV moving in the right direction in snow and ice.
There are a number of elements that can affect the ATV tire chains’ traction. For example a diamond chain pattern can improve traction in snow and ice. Our Number 5 Pick, the Kimpex USA Diamond V-Bar Tire Chains has such a pattern.
Such a pattern requires more individual links and a higher weight of chain, which means it will cost more money. On one hand, some people would say that a diamond chain pattern is worth the extra money, but on the other hand many people are happy with a simpler chain that reaches from the outside of the tire to the inside.
The more frequent the cross chains across the tire, the better the grip and traction. But this means more individual links and a higher price. But on this issue we are more opinionated, and we recommend that you go for more frequent cross chains.
Durability
An ATV tire chain could see a hell of a lot of sustained wear. Each link in the chain will at some point see a lot of weight placed on it as it moves with the tires. It needs to be durable. You should look for chains that are solid, rugged and durable.
The recommendations in our Top 5 picks are all metal (we’ll discuss plastic alternatives ). And with durability in mind, you can get some that are zinc plated, which helps provide better adhesion, combats rust, and increases the durability.

Tire Chains versus Snow Tires
Of course if your ATV tires are designed to tolerate snowy and icy conditions, like some of them are, you may decide there’s no need to buy tire chains.
But if not, there are advantages of going for tire chains than a whole new set of ATV tires. A tire chain is available at a fraction of the price of a new ATV tire. So this would be a good choice if your ATV tires are in good condition and don’t need to be replaced.
If you feel that snow tires would be better value for you, say if you live in an area that sees a lot of snow, or if you bought the ATV for the purpose of snow plowing,it would certainly be worth your while looking into getting ATV tires that are designed with such conditions in mind.
Metal Tire Chains versus Plastic Tire Cables
On the one hand, plastic tire cables are both more lightweight and easier to put on and take off than their metal counterparts. And they are cheaper! You can see why people might consider them.
When it counts, plastic tire cables are likely to let you down. They don’t provide the same level of traction that you get with metal tire chains. And metal tire chains are more resistant to corrosion, since many of them are zinc plated. Our advice is not to compromise. Safety first, always.

Should you put chains on all 4 tires?
You should put tire chains on all four tires, because by using four tire chains, you’ll be able to obtain the best possible traction and balance.
But if that’s what people did, you’d see tire chains being sold in packs of four than in pairs. Front-wheel-drive ATVs must put snow chains on their front tires, and this is why ATV tire chains are sold in pairs.
